Effective March 26, 2008, there are new waste regulations for composting yard clippings per Act 212 of 2007 which amends Part 115, Solid Waste Management, of Act 451 of 1994 and administrative rules. Yard clippings includes leaves, grass clippings, vegetable or other garden debris, shrubbery, or brush and tree trimmings less than 4 feet in length and 2 inches in diameter. It does not include stumps, agricultural waste, animal waste, roots, sewage sludge, or garbage.
The Departments of Environmental Quality and Agriculture are developing guidance and forms at this time which will be posted here when available.
